Abstract/Contents:"Twenty-eight zoysiagrasses, including 19 cultivars from NTEP program and 9 selections from Texas A&M Univ., Dallas, TX, were established at TAES-Dallas Center for evaluation in July 1996. DALZ9601, Emerald, HT-210, Cavalier, TAES4355, Zeon and Z-18 had the finest leaf-texture, Victoria and DeAnza had medium leaf-texture, and Miyako, El-Toro and J-36 were the most coarse leaf-textured entries. Cavalier, DALZ9601, Zeon, Emerald, Meyer and Palisades had darker green color than other entries. The most rapid establishment was observed for TAES4366 and TAES 4365. El-Toro, Jamur, Miyako and TAES4370 also exhibited a relatively fast establishment rate. Among the seeded entries, J-36 and J-37 were the first to germinate, and they had the highest seedling vigor and fastest establishment rate. Z-18 had poor low temperature resistance, and died during the winter of 1996-1997. Green-up and color retention data showed that Emerald, DALZ9601, Cavalier and Zeon had a longer growing season than the others."
